Hello all :)

Is there a way to increase the maximum number of hit points on a creature, perhaps in the "on spawn"? I have an application for monsters with a great deal more hit points than their normal counterparts, and wondered if I could script this instead of creating a bunch of blueprints.

I see GetMaxHitPoints() but there is no matching Set.

Yes OnSpawn is the best place for it. I have on vault a script system that can do it, its called Boost System a variable driven random boosts. And it does allow to add hitpoints. If you would be interested about this look here.

Without NWNX you can only use EffectTemporaryHitPoints which is a bit odd in early levels when monsters have 10hp and you add them 2hp, because if player damages monster by 1 point of damage, monster will appear not damaged.

With NWNX you can use nwnx_funcs (windows) which has a function to SetMaxHitPoints (but it doesnt set current hitpoints as well so you have to heal your creature as well)
